Commercial Description:
A clean, softly malted body with a hint of citrus overtones, followed by a hop-accented dry, crisp finish.

Cloudy golden color with a small but lasting white head. The aroma is terriffic: citrusy and pineapple. Flavor is very hoppy. Bitterness is in style and not overpowering as you would expect with all of the hops in the flavor and nose. Enough malty sweetness to carry hoppiness. Reminds me of Dreadnaught’s little brother, must try this again to make sure I’m not delusional. Second rating. Consistent with the first rating but a little sulfuric? taste. Aroma is still good. 4.4 down to a 4.2, maybe I'm a little critical since I've initially rated so high.
